Neck stiffness/ Spondylosis / Back head ache/ Facial  paralysis.

3/9/2013

 
Picture
Neck stiffness/ Spondylosis/ Back head ache/ Facial  paralysis.

Location: Keep your hand with the nail of the thumb up. Move your thumb up and back (away from the palm of your hand),  this reveals a depression at the bottom of the thumb, called the "anatomic snuffbox" (between two tendons). Move your finger from the anatomic snuffbox along the side of your lower arm, until  you feel a bone sticking out (about a thumb's width from it).
          LU-7 is located on that bone, in between the two tendons you feel there. You can press it with the nail of your thumb or index finger.

Effects: Heals effects on the body of too much grief.

Acupuncture Point LU 7
